Barbara S. Curates ‘Echoes of Ice’ Exhibition in Berlin
Barbara brings a compelling collection of Nordic-inspired artworks to Berlin’s cultural scene, exploring profound themes of memory, climate, and cultural heritage. The exhibition invites visitors into a deeply immersive experience, where installations skillfully blend sound, space, and emotional resonance. Each piece reflects a dialogue between the past and present, encouraging contemplation on environmental change and collective memory.
